    1. General The steam sterilizer described in this manual is intended for the sterilization of instruments and tools in the medical, dental, beauty, veterinarian and tattoo fields. It is a fully automatic steam sterilizer with 134 °C and 121 °C sterilization temperatures. This sterilizer is in compliance with the European Directive 93/42/CEE, Health Canada, ISO 13485, ETL, CSA and it has been produced in accordance with the EN 13060.

    4. Installation * Ensure that the sterilizer is installed with 10cm (4”) ventilation space on all sides of the sterilizer and 20cm (8”) on the top. The clearance required to open the door is 40cm (16”). * The sterilizer should be placed on a level work table. * Do not cover or block the door or any ventilation areas on the sterilizer.

  • Page 15 7.4 Door adjustment Under normal circumstances, the chamber door does not require adjustments. However, if the seal fails (resulting in steam leaking from the front of the chamber), you may use the spanner tool to tighten the door seal. 7.4.1 Open the door. 7.4.2 Insert the spanner tool in the gap beneath the plastic cover.

    Certificate of Warranty All new Clave16 (+) or Clave 23 (+) or Class B autoclaves installed by a Flight Dental Systems authorized dealer are covered for a period of two (2) full years from the time of purchase. The warranty covers defects in parts, workmanship and materials for two (2) years except for door gaskets and filters which are wear and tear items.
